Packers Activate Andrew Quarless from Injured Reserve

The Green Bay Packers have activated TE Andrew Quarless from injured reserve – designated for return and placed WR Ty Montgomery on injured reserve. The transactions were announced Monday by Executive Vice President, General Manager and Director of Football Operations Ted Thompson.

Quarless, the first of two fifth-round choices by the Packers in the 2010 NFL Draft, has started 26 of 58 games played for Green Bay in his career, registering 87 receptions for 923 yards (10.6 avg.) and six touchdowns. He played in three games this season before suffering a knee injury in Week 3 versus Kansas City.

Montgomery played in six games with three starts this season, catching 15 passes for 136 yards (9.1 avg.) and two touchdowns. He also rushed for 14 yards on three attempts (4.7 average)  and averaged 31.1 yards on seven kickoff returns.
